A very good friend of mine send me this video a little while ago, it's short only 11 min but it was very interesting, during 2020 a drop in temperature was observed on the surface on the moon, a study made the case that it was caused by earthshine, a phenomena where light reflected by the earth affects the surface of the moon. They suggested that the drop in human activity due to the lockdowns and the drop in green house gases caused earthshine to diminish and thus lower temperatures.

But the guy on the video then cites another study in which a closer inspection actually shows a drop in temperature on the moon during 2019 and 2018, no lockdowns. Moreover he says that earthshine could not account for such a drastic drop on the moon, 5 degrees C, so it remains a mystery.
